The winter season is howling, her cold cruel breath blanketing the great New York state. On the bright side this has minimized the helicopter traffic and prying eyes from braving the vicinity of Xavier’s School. The mutants huddled together on the inside however have a much more difficult time seeing it that way.
With the growing student character population and the grim situation looming over mutant kind, training even the most docile of students cannot be put off any longer. While Logan Howlett would prefer that kids have a chance to be kids, reality calls and he is responsible for overseeing the progress of combat and physical training classes until further notice. As a result, there are monthly sign-up sheets for student characters needing training and senior students needing credit toward their shot at graduating to X-Men. Depending on the needs of the student and staff body, more X-Men may be asked to run training classes in the future. The way these threads will run, however, may look a bit different. Please be sure you have read the expectations here before signing up any of your characters.
The Mutant Response Division has been slowly working its way across the United States of America. Many cells in their holding facilities across the nation have been filled, and the MRD or the ‘Division’ has become a household and federally-used name in regards to conversations dealing with mutantkind.
The Brotherhood of Mutants have a new base of operations, a secluded military base on the Connecticut/New York border, about twenty-five miles from Westchester County, New York, the location of Xavier’s School. The military base, surrounded by several hundred acres, offers the privacy and space that the Brotherhood didn’t have in the old MRD headquarters compound.
The X-Men have been working around the clock to ensure that Xavier’s School for Gifted Youngsters remains a safe haven for the students and those seeking refuge alike. X-Men are sent out to recruit young mutants to bring them and family members looking for a safe haven to the school where the mutants can be educated about their powers and the world around them as well as figuring out a way to integrate their family (if foreign and needing refuge) into one of the safe house locations. Classes continue as normal for students, but powers training and self-defense, as well as the general training it takes to become an X-Man, are required as well. Not all students become X-Men, but all are trained in combat.
